Some mixed trigonometric complex soliton solutions to the perturbed nonlinear Schrödinger equation

Abstract
This work deals with finding new complex solitons to the perturbed nonlinear Schrödinger model with the help of an analytical method. Using several computation programs, we gain entirely new solitons to the considering model. Under the choice of suitable values of the parameters, density graphs to the reported solutions, such as complex, hyperbolic, trigonometric and exponential, are successfully presented. Simulations in various dimensions are also plotted by using package programs.
